Output 5642123e279995b42fc9055fd52db5c1a3976df93f74bce308f69d616bf078f8:5

value
1038979
script pubkey
OP_0 OP_PUSHBYTES_20 507073c0a46a1460920fb7103fb7bcc52410b850
address
bc1q2pc88s9ydg2xpys0kugrldauc5jppwzsezqg9x
transaction
5642123e279995b42fc9055fd52db5c1a3976df93f74bce308f69d616bf078f8